Output 907fa01d55d9678e7a38bf4e1e21d4480e849cc0a6389e97f0ed59115edbf02f:0

value
67066300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87e90804231c0ee4b95c21403d8c7a051790028f OP_EQUAL
address
MLHncdJkcBxvVzAVpayo2y2a2Fff59pzRR
transaction
907fa01d55d9678e7a38bf4e1e21d4480e849cc0a6389e97f0ed59115edbf02f
spent
true